  • [8× Faster Than Cigarette Lighter Charger] The 800W Alternator Charger full recharges an EcoFlow DELTA 2 portable power station (1kWh) on an 80 minute drive. Charge with excess alternator energy so you can power your essential appliances, such as phones, coffee makers and lights when you're on the go or off-grid.

  • [3-in-1 Charger, Maintainer and Jump Starter] Three integrated features that charge your power station, keep your vehicle battery in peak condition and acts as a jump starter when you need it most.

  • [Extend Battery Runtime] Transform your overlanding and vanlife experience with our plug-and-play portable power station. Perfect for supplementing your 12V RV house battery, and extending your runtime. It's not just for use in your van, our compact and lightweight power stations can be taken off-grid and used to power the outdoors.

  • [Safe Charging & Vehicle Protection] By using GaN technology the Alternator Charger converts more electricity without any risk of overheating even when charging at high speeds. The charger protects your vehicle against reverse polarity, overcurrent, short circuit, over and under voltage. Includes a 2-year warranty.
